Hut 8 AI Data Center Leases Surge to 949MW, $26.6B Contract Value

2026-08-05 22:02

Hut 8 secures 949MW AI capacity worth $26.6B, refinances BTC debt, and raises $7.5B in project financing, though Q2 net loss hits $177M due to digital asset losses.

Woofun AI reports that Hut 8 announced its second-quarter 2026 financial results, highlighting progress in its "power-first" strategy. The company secured 949MW of contracted IT capacity for its AI data center business, representing approximately $26.6 billion in underlying contract value. This includes a second 352MW lease at the Beacon Point campus with a high-investment-grade client, adding $9.8 billion in contract value and $655 million in annual NOI.

Hut 8 generated $74.9 million in revenue, an 81% year-over-year increase, but posted a net loss of $177.1 million, primarily driven by $138.6 million in unrealized digital asset losses. The company refinanced a $200 million Bitcoin-collateralized credit facility, reducing interest costs from 9% to 7% and releasing 3,300 BTC.

Additionally, Hut 8 completed $7.5 billion in non-dilutive investment-grade project financing for its River Bend and Beacon Point campuses.

The significant expansion in AI data center contracts demonstrates Hut 8's successful pivot from pure mining to diversified infrastructure, potentially stabilizing revenue streams against crypto volatility. The reduction in debt costs and release of BTC collateral improve balance sheet flexibility, while the substantial project financing indicates strong institutional confidence in its energy assets. However, the heavy reliance on unrealized digital asset gains/losses for net income metrics suggests continued earnings volatility tied to BTC price movements.
